HuprineX

Carbobicyclic substructure of huperzine A, with the 4-aminoquinoline substructure of tacrine

General

Type : Derivative of Huperzine,Derivative of Tacrine,Quinoline,Natural_modified

Chemical_Nomenclature : (-)-12-amino-3-chloro-9-ethyl-6,7,10,11-tetrahydro-7,11-methanocycloocta[b]quinoline hydrochloride

Canonical SMILES : CCC1=CC2CC(C1)C3=C(C4=C(C=C(C=C4)Cl)N=C3C2)N

InChI : InChI=1S\/C18H19ClN2\/c1-2-10-5-11-7-12(6-10)17-16(8-11)21-15-9-13(19)3-4-14(15)18(17)20\/h3-5,9,11-12H,2,6-8H2,1H3,(H2,20,21)

InChIKey : QTPHSDHUHXUYFE-UHFFFAOYSA-N

Other name(s) : Rac-huprine H7,Huprine x,CHEMBL143812,3-chloro-9-ethyl-6,7,10,11-tetrahydro-7,11-methanocycloocta[b]quinolin-12-amine,AC1L1GD8,SCHEMBL7115053


MW : 298.81

Formula : C18H19N2Cl
